Guest guest Posted May 21, 2010 Report Share Posted May 21, 2010 This is a recipe for a nice break from PURELY healthy treats. The sodium is a little higher than most meals and it contains dairy and meat juices which is not for you vegans out there, but oh is it good. -------------- Saute 2 sliced up very large yellow onions in dutch oven/pot in 5oz of olive oil and butter/butter substitute. Reduce the onions to brown. Optionally add half a cup of dry white whine. -------------- In the vitamix pour 1 of those beef broth boxes/or vegan substitute from the grocery. Put in 1/2 - 1 carrot and 1/2 - 1 celery stalk Put in 1 beef bouillon cube Add salt and pepper to taste and mix until warm. -------------- Pour vitamix contents in dutch oven/pot and reduce by 20-40%(to taste) while stirring regularly. -------------- Pour contents in ceramic bowls, drops in 5-6 salad croutons, cover with 3-4 slices of cheese. (I prefer mozzarella and provolone), broil in oven on high until cheese is 50% browned. -------------- Eat best damn french onion soup ever. Recommend dipping garlic Parmesan bread chips of some sort, but that just increases calories.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
